Thought I would share this as it's transformed Camtasia for me.
Its always been sluggish for me, even on a decent spec PC with 64GB of RAM, but this week for some reason it went near unusable. I dug into the settings and told it to use my GTX 1660 for hardware acceleration rather than the RTX 3060Ti. Don't know if it just likes that card better, or because one card is now used for the display Camtasia is running on, with the second card for rendering, but it's transformed the application. All the lagging and sluggishness navigating the timeline is gone, it's like a totally different program.
I run six screens, so have a pair of NVIDIA GPUs to give me enough physical ports, and up to now Camtasia was using my primary GPU, which drives the primary (center) monitor.
Telling it to use the 2nd GPU instead has made an insane difference. Task manager was showing Camtasia pegging the GPU at 100% before with the video paused and me doing nothing. Now neither the CPU nor GPU go over 30% during editing, and the application is properly responsive. It actually feels like I can interact with it, instead of making a change and waiting for the app to catch up.

Quando coloco o vídeo raw no Camtasia nada acontece, mas após a renderização aparecem frames pretos ao longo do vídeo e, quando volto ao modo de edição, esses frames também aparecem na edição. Alguém sabe por que isso acontece e como resolver?
Solved:
Thanks to those who tried to help, although I think I explained myself poorly and everyone thought I had left gaps in the editing, but the problem was in the rendering because the entire video had this problem.
How I solved it:
For the record, I am using version 2022 of Camtasia. And it had presented this problem when I tried to speed up a scene. So this time I sped up the entire video to 1.02 and the black frames disappeared. But the acceleration is not high enough to be noticeable.
